Ganol - Dholka, Ahmedabad

Ganol is a village situated in the Dholka taluka of Ahmedabad district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 22 km from Dholka and around 70 km from Ahmadabad. Ganol village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Ganol is 511742. The village covers a total geographical area of 1309.12 hectares and falls under the 382265 pincode. Dholka is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.

Ganol village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dholka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kheda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Ganol

According to the 2011 Census, Ganol village had a total population of 1,719 people, including 900 males and 819 females, living in 336 households. The sex ratio was 910 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 76.66%, with male literacy at 88.24% and female literacy at 63.83%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 317.

Transport and Connectivity of Ganol

Ganol is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Ganol.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ceYesAvailable within village
Private Bus ServiceNoAvailable within >10 km
Railway StationNoAvailable within >10 km

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Dholka to Ganol is about 22 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Ahmadabad to Ganol is about 70 km, with the usual travel time around ~2 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
